This refreshingly spirited homage to kung fu films of yore belies the conceits of the digital age, while paying special tribute to Jet Li’s 1982 watershed The Shaolin Temple. While it still looks contemporary, Rising Shaolin blends “now” with “then” to produce a rousing spectacle of martial-arts fury with a perennial moral of might for right. Star Wang Baoqiang (Detective Chinatown), both a cutup and a dedicated martial artist, throws irreverent comedy and kinetic action into a highly entertaining mix of slapstick, pathos, and unbridled adventure. It’s a hero’s journey of redemption paved with violence, featuring choreography reminiscent of the kung fu greats.
